Teens and Gun Crime


Gun violence poses a serious threat to America's young people. A teenager in this country is more likely to die from a gunshot wound than from all natural causes of death combined. Even though we have made progress in reducing violent crime in the United States, the rates of crimes committed with guns continues to be among the highest in the industrialized world The PSAs encourage youth to think about the repercussions of gun crimes and reminds them that the consequences, death or jail time, just as seriously affect their families.
